Auftrag beendet
Spezifikation
Входные параметры (изменяемые):
Период определения максимума для покупок (MaxBuy)
Период определения минимума для покупок (MinBuy)
Период определения максимума для продаж (MaxSell)
Период определения минимума для продаж (MinSell)
Лот (Lot)
Коэффициент для покупок (ConstBuy)
Коэффициент для продаж (ConstSell)
Мейджик номер (MagicNumber)
Направление торговли (выбор из вариантов : покупки и продажи, только покупки, только продажи)
Торговая логика:
Для покупок:
Проверяем нет ли открытых позиций на покупку. Если открытых позиций нет, выставляем 2 отложенных ордера на покупку выше линии MaxBuy (или 1 отложенный ордер равный Lot*2).
При срабатывании ордеров (ордера) на покупку выставляем стоп-лосс на уровне MinBuy. Стоп- лосс динамически изменяется при изменении уровня MinBuy.
Тейк профит (тоже динамически изменяемый) используем только для одного из двух ордеров (половины ордера) на уровне по формуле:
цена покупки+(цена покупки - MinBuy)*ConstBuy;
Второй ордер сопровождается только стоп-лосом на уровне MinBuy, без тейк-профита.
Для продаж:
Проверяем нет ли открытых позиций на продажу. Если открытых позиций нет, выставляем 2 отложенных ордера на продажу ниже линии MinSell (или 1 отложенный ордер равный Lot*2).
При срабатывании ордеров (ордера) на продажу выставляем стоп-лосс на уровне MaxSell. Стоп- лосс динамически изменяется при изменении уровня MaxSell.
Тейк профит (тоже динамически изменяемый) используем только для одного из двух ордеров (половины ордера) на уровне по формуле:
цена продажи - (MaxSell - цена продажи)*ConstSell;
Второй ордер сопровождается только стоп-лосом на уровне MaxSell, без тейк-профита.
Примечание:
Желательно чтобы линии поддержки сопротивления прорисовывались на графике (получится что-то вроде каналов Дончиана).
Использование мейджик номера для заявок - обязательно.